US Facility & Trading Update

9 Jan 2006 07:00

Smallbone PLC09 January 2006 SMALLBONE plc("Smallbone or "the Group") New Production facility for Paris Ceramics in the US andTrading update Smallbone plc, the supplier of luxury kitchens and stone flooring, is pleased toannounce that it is moving Paris Ceramics Inc's ("PCI") head office and mainwarehouse facility from Connecticut to Farmville, Virginia. The newly built52,000 sq ft premises will replace its 15,000 sq ft Newark warehouse and officesand will provide PCI with a state of the art stone cutting, processing andtreatment facility unrivalled in its market. This substantially enhancedvertical integration of the business brings PCI's operations more into line withthose of its fellow operating subsidiaries, Smallbone of Devizes and MarkWilkinson Furniture ("MWF"). The new facility is expected to be fullyoperational from 15 January 2006 and, through this move, PCI will be able toincrease production volumes; improve margins; and gain better control over thedevelopment and protection of its unique product offerings. The total cost of the new premises, production equipment and associatedrelocation costs will be approximately $2.6m, largely funded by grants and loansfrom local state government agencies together with capital equipment leasingfacilities. The annual servicing costs of these additional borrowings andadditional production staff costs will be more than covered by the savings frompremises costs in Connecticut together with savings in supplier costs due tomore in-house production. To ensure that PCI's management team are able to focuson bedding in the new facility and generating the planned margin improvements,the opening of two new US showrooms anticipated for PCI in 2006 will be delayedto 2007. An initial 17,000 sq ft of the new facility has been set aside for Smallbone, tosupply the anticipated increase in demand expected through the opening of theSmallbone flagship showroom in New York, in the first half of 2006, and theprojected roll out of the Smallbone showroom network in the US. As a result ofthis anticipated increase in demand in the US, a similar separate manufacturingfacility will also be considered for Smallbone, which management expect to berequired in the next couple of years. As a centre for raw lumber and furnituremanufacturing, Virginia is considered to be an ideal location for such afacility. The Directors are pleased to report that they anticipate trading to be in linewith their expectations for 2005 and have experienced a strong increase inoperating cash flow compared to 2004. The integration and trading of MarkWilkinson Furniture is going to plan although there has been a slower thananticipated reduction in their working capital requirements. Despitechallenging UK market conditions, particularly in the north, performances fromnew UK stores and export sales have been ahead of management expectations andmean that the Group starts 2006 with order book levels in line with theDirectors' plans. Charles Smallbone, Chairman and Chief Executive of Smallbone, commented: "This move is a very exciting step for the Group and paves the way for a similarSmallbone facility in the future. We are almost quadrupling our production andwarehousing space and making a considerable investment into advanced productiontechnologies for PCI, which we expect will improve its profitability in 2006 andbeyond. This move will also further enhance and expand our niche position,providing bespoke products to our clients across the Group. We believe that noother company in our field will be able to match the flexibility and uniquerange of options that we will be able to provide our clients. I am very pleased that we expect performance for 2005 to be in line with ourplans, especially against the background of challenging market conditions in theUK. We set ourselves some ambitious targets for 2005, even excluding theacquisition of Mark Wilkinson Furniture in June. Our core expansion strategy ofbroadening our distribution base by opening new showrooms has already started tobenefit the Group's performance as anticipated and Smallbone's forthcomingflagship New York showroom will be the first step into what we perceive as a bignew market opportunity for us in 2006 and beyond." 9 January 2006Enquiries: SMALLBONE plc Tel: +44 (0)1380 729090Charles Smallbone, Chairman & Chief ExecutiveGordon Montgomery, Finance Director COLLEGE HILL Tel: +44 (0)207 457 2020Nick Elwes / Kate Pope Notes to editors: The Group is comprised of Smallbone of Devizes and Mark Wilkinson Furniture, twoof the UK's leading designers of bespoke kitchens, bathrooms and bedroomfurniture; and Paris Ceramics, a supplier of high quality stone primarilyoperating in the US.
